pongolensis, Mugilogobius Kok [H. M.] & Blaber [S. J. M.] 1977:163, Fig. 1-2 [Zoologica Africana v. 12 (no. 1); ref. 7260] Nsimbu River, Pongolo floodplain, Zululand, KwaZulu-Natal, South Africa. Holotype: SAIAB [formerly RUSI] 807. Paratypes: SAIAB [formerly RUSI] 808-817 (1 ea., total 10). •Valid as Redigobius pongolensis (Kok & Blaber 1977) -- (Maugé 1986:382 [ref. 6218]). •Synonym of Redigobius dewaalii (Weber 1897) -- (Hoese 1986:803 [ref. 5670], Larson 2001:207 [ref. 25522], Larson 2022:170 [ref. 39971]). Current status: Synonym of Redigobius dewaali (Weber 1897). Oxudercidae: Gobionellinae. Habitat: freshwater, brackish.
